1. CONTEXT
The world has realized that the best innovations come from the age group of 18-22. This is the best age group to introduce students to a formal research culture so that their ideas get channelized and they develop a passion for research and innovation. The aim of starting this Undergraduate Research Forum (URF) is to provide a formal and structured platform for the motivated and merited undergraduate students to get into a research mode right during their UG studies. This will motivate these students to take up higher studies in high ranked universities within India abroad which in turn will pave way for newer research based career opportunities.
2. PRESENT SCENARIO
Highly meritorious and research oriented students have a deep interest to carry out a focused work towards publishing quality research papers, developing prototypes, working on new algorithms, carrying out patentable work etc. To facilitate the research active UG students to get into the research right during their UG studies, RNSIT has taken the unique initiative of starting the “Undergraduate Research Forum” at the institute level. This is a formal body with a well defined charter is an effective platform to promote research at the undergraduate level. This is a very novel concept not initiated by most universities in India

4. Expected Outcomes
- Inculcate research culture in students right at the UG level
- Promote Inter-Disciplinary Projects
- Create a platform for students from across branches and years of study to work together in Teams with close mentoring from the faculty
- Promote system thinking in students
- Enable students to improve their problem-solving skills
- Promote project-based learning in students
- Enable students to be more confident, with high self esteem
- To create In-House Internship Opportunities for students
- Define new research-based career avenues for students
- Enable students to participate in project competitions/Hackathons within India and Abroad
- Promote students to take up higher studies in top Universities within India and Abroad
- Create a high branding for the university
- A ready pool of skilled students available for faculty to take up projects (both externally funded and in-house) of various kinds. The senior students will be very valuable mentors for younger batches.
- The Alumni of this forum will associate with the institute and will be a big asset for the institution. It creates a sense of Belongingness for the institution.
- Industries/companies will be highly interested in offering projects to the lab when expertise is developed in a few chosen areas.
- At one point, industries will be ready to fund the activities of the lab.
